Who is the darkest woman in the world?

Nyakim Gatwech

Nyakim Gatwech hailed as the world’s darkest model, has pioneered in this area. Her captivating looks and glowing complexion have charmed the globe, yet she faced many obstacles on the way to achieving self-confidence. Gatwech battled self-acceptance and racial discrimination. However, as they dubbed her “Queen of Dark,” her fans’ encouragement and the influence of social media have given her the courage to be who she truly is.

Gatwech’s motto, “Black is bold, black is beautiful, black is gold,” has become a life philosophy for many who have grappled with accepting their skin tones in a world that has often upheld narrow beauty standards. Her story is a testament to the strength of self-love and the importance of embracing one’s uniqueness.
